Output 95cb921438f343ba65e4b3893cedfd7c6ffbacc99ba97abfe3ee5b5bb7cd6aa5:31

value
650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 567de1480a927b4e7d8cab4f59805ac60e642944 OP_EQUAL
address
39aLqLWtAcLtLogn4N3T4j6JJph7njNHSq
transaction
95cb921438f343ba65e4b3893cedfd7c6ffbacc99ba97abfe3ee5b5bb7cd6aa5
spent
true